Low Scores reflect end of Cheating Era in UTME – Minister

The Minister of Education, Tunji Alausa, has attributed the low performance in the 2025 unified tertiary matriculation examination (UTME) results to the improved integrity of the exam process.
The minister said on Tuesday during a channels’ TV Show that the outcome of the exam reflects a system where cheating has been drastically reduced. Alausa said the results from the joint admissions and matriculation board (JAMB) should not be viewed as a national setback but rather as a realistic reflection of the level of academic preparedness among students when examinations are conducted properly
